ALL Family Farm is a family-owned business focused on providing high-quality Berkshire pork products directly to consumers. They emphasize humane and natural farming practices, offering a variety of pork cuts, including sausages and bacon, while also providing an educational experience about their farming methods. The farm aims to support local communities by promoting fresh, sustainable meat alternatives to supermarket options.
